namespace osmium {

    namespace io {

        namespace detail {

            struct opl_output_options {

                /// Should metadata of objects be added?
                bool add_metadata;

                /// Should node locations be added to ways?
                bool locations_on_ways;

                /// Write in form of a diff file?
                bool format_as_diff;

            };

            /**
             * Writes out one buffer with OSM data in OPL format.
             */
            class OPLOutputBlock : public OutputBlock {

                opl_output_options m_options;

                void append_encoded_string(const char* data) {
                    osmium::io::detail::append_utf8_encoded_string(*m_out, data);
                }

                void write_field_int(char c, int64_t value) {
                    *m_out += c;
                    output_int(value);
                }

                void write_field_timestamp(char c, const osmium::Timestamp& timestamp) {
                    *m_out += c;
                    *m_out += timestamp.to_iso();
                }

                void write_tags(const osmium::TagList& tags) {
                    *m_out += " T";

                    if (tags.empty()) {
                        return;
                    }

                    auto it = tags.begin();
                    append_encoded_string(it->key());
                    *m_out += '=';
                    append_encoded_string(it->value());

                    for (++it; it != tags.end(); ++it) {
                        *m_out += ',';
                        append_encoded_string(it->key());
                        *m_out += '=';
                        append_encoded_string(it->value());
                    }
                }

                void write_meta(const osmium::OSMObject& object) {
                    output_int(object.id());
                    if (m_options.add_metadata) {
                        *m_out += ' ';
                        write_field_int('v', object.version());
                        *m_out += " d";
                        *m_out += (object.visible() ? 'V' : 'D');
                        *m_out += ' ';
                        write_field_int('c', object.changeset());
                        *m_out += ' ';
                        write_field_timestamp('t', object.timestamp());
                        *m_out += ' ';
                        write_field_int('i', object.uid());
                        *m_out += " u";
                        append_encoded_string(object.user());
                    }
                    write_tags(object.tags());
                }

                void write_location(const osmium::Location& location, const char x, const char y) {
                    *m_out += ' ';
                    *m_out += x;
                    if (location) {
                        osmium::detail::append_location_coordinate_to_string(std::back_inserter(*m_out), location.x());
                    }
                    *m_out += ' ';
                    *m_out += y;
                    if (location) {
                        osmium::detail::append_location_coordinate_to_string(std::back_inserter(*m_out), location.y());
                    }
                }

                void write_diff(const osmium::OSMObject& object) {
                    if (m_options.format_as_diff) {
                        *m_out += object.diff_as_char();
                    }
                }

            public:

                OPLOutputBlock(osmium::memory::Buffer&& buffer, const opl_output_options& options) :
                    OutputBlock(std::move(buffer)),
                    m_options(options) {
                }

                OPLOutputBlock(const OPLOutputBlock&) = default;
                OPLOutputBlock& operator=(const OPLOutputBlock&) = default;

                OPLOutputBlock(OPLOutputBlock&&) = default;
                OPLOutputBlock& operator=(OPLOutputBlock&&) = default;

                ~OPLOutputBlock() noexcept = default;

                std::string operator()() {
                    osmium::apply(m_input_buffer->cbegin(), m_input_buffer->cend(), *this);

                    std::string out;
                    using std::swap;
                    swap(out, *m_out);

                    return out;
                }

                void node(const osmium::Node& node) {
                    write_diff(node);
                    *m_out += 'n';
                    write_meta(node);
                    write_location(node.location(), 'x', 'y');
                    *m_out += '\n';
                }

                void write_field_ref(const osmium::NodeRef& node_ref) {
                    write_field_int('n', node_ref.ref());
                    *m_out += 'x';
                    if (node_ref.location()) {
                        node_ref.location().as_string(std::back_inserter(*m_out), 'y');
                    } else {
                        *m_out += 'y';
                    }
                }

                void way(const osmium::Way& way) {
                    write_diff(way);
                    *m_out += 'w';
                    write_meta(way);

                    *m_out += " N";

                    if (!way.nodes().empty()) {
                        auto it = way.nodes().begin();
                        if (m_options.locations_on_ways) {
                            write_field_ref(*it);
                            for (++it; it != way.nodes().end(); ++it) {
                                *m_out += ',';
                                write_field_ref(*it);
                            }
                        } else {
                            write_field_int('n', it->ref());
                            for (++it; it != way.nodes().end(); ++it) {
                                *m_out += ',';
                                write_field_int('n', it->ref());
                            }
                        }
                    }

                    *m_out += '\n';
                }

                void relation_member(const osmium::RelationMember& member) {
                    *m_out += item_type_to_char(member.type());
                    output_int(member.ref());
                    *m_out += '@';
                    append_encoded_string(member.role());
                }

                void relation(const osmium::Relation& relation) {
                    write_diff(relation);
                    *m_out += 'r';
                    write_meta(relation);

                    *m_out += " M";

                    if (!relation.members().empty()) {
                        auto it = relation.members().begin();
                        relation_member(*it);
                        for (++it; it != relation.members().end(); ++it) {
                            *m_out += ',';
                            relation_member(*it);
                        }
                    }

                    *m_out += '\n';
                }

                void changeset(const osmium::Changeset& changeset) {
                    write_field_int('c', changeset.id());
                    *m_out += ' ';
                    write_field_int('k', changeset.num_changes());
                    *m_out += ' ';
                    write_field_timestamp('s', changeset.created_at());
                    *m_out += ' ';
                    write_field_timestamp('e', changeset.closed_at());
                    *m_out += ' ';
                    write_field_int('d', changeset.num_comments());
                    *m_out += ' ';
                    write_field_int('i', changeset.uid());
                    *m_out += " u";
                    append_encoded_string(changeset.user());
                    write_location(changeset.bounds().bottom_left(), 'x', 'y');
                    write_location(changeset.bounds().top_right(), 'X', 'Y');
                    write_tags(changeset.tags());
                    *m_out += '\n';
                }

            }; // class OPLOutputBlock

            class OPLOutputFormat : public osmium::io::detail::OutputFormat {

                opl_output_options m_options;

            public:

                OPLOutputFormat(const osmium::io::File& file, future_string_queue_type& output_queue) :
                    OutputFormat(output_queue),
                    m_options() {
                    m_options.add_metadata      = file.is_not_false("add_metadata");
                    m_options.locations_on_ways = file.is_true("locations_on_ways");
                    m_options.format_as_diff    = file.is_true("diff");
                }

                OPLOutputFormat(const OPLOutputFormat&) = delete;
                OPLOutputFormat& operator=(const OPLOutputFormat&) = delete;

                ~OPLOutputFormat() noexcept final = default;

                void write_buffer(osmium::memory::Buffer&& buffer) final {
                    m_output_queue.push(osmium::thread::Pool::instance().submit(OPLOutputBlock{std::move(buffer), m_options}));
                }

            }; // class OPLOutputFormat

            // we want the register_output_format() function to run, setting
            // the variable is only a side-effect, it will never be used
            const bool registered_opl_output = osmium::io::detail::OutputFormatFactory::instance().register_output_format(osmium::io::file_format::opl,
                [](const osmium::io::File& file, future_string_queue_type& output_queue) {
                    return new osmium::io::detail::OPLOutputFormat(file, output_queue);
            });

            // dummy function to silence the unused variable warning from above
            inline bool get_registered_opl_output() noexcept {
                return registered_opl_output;
            }

        } // namespace detail

    } // namespace io

} // namespace osmium
